ORP Wicher christened, but Polish Navy ages faster than it renews its fleet
Reserve commander Krzysztof Ligęza warns that despite the christening of the new vessel ORP Wicher, the backbone of the Polish Navy still consists of ageing ships from the 1980s. He says the navy's combat capabilities will shrink before new ships enter service. In his assessment, the threat in the Baltic Sea is constant and growing as Poland's defensive capacity declines.
